# Routines for generating and parsing KiCAD files

There are multiple python scripts that read and write kicad file
formats. Currently there is the problem that each project reimplements
basic parsing and serialization of these formats.

The aim of this project is to provide high quality and well tested
format support so that other projects can focus on the interesting
stuff.


## Usage
```python
from pykicad.pcb import *
from pykicad.module import *

vi, vo, gnd = Net(1, 'VI'), Net(2, 'VO'), Net(3, 'GND')

r1 = Module.from_library('Resistors_SMD', 'R_0805')
r2 = Module.from_library('Resistors_SMD', 'R_0805')

r1.pads[0].net = vi
r1.pads[1].net = vo
r2.pads[0].net = vo
r2.pads[1].net = gnd

pcb = Pcb()
pcb.modules += [r1, r2]
pcb.nets += [vi, vo, gnd]

with open('project.kicad_pcb', 'w+') as f:
f.write(str(pcb))
```


## Supported file formats

* Modules (*.pretty, *.kicad_mod) in module.py
* Pcbnew (*.kicad_pcb) in pcb.py


# API docs
## modules.py
### Classes
* Module(name, descr, tags, layer, pads, texts, lines, circles, arcs, model)
* Pad(name, type, shape, drill, at, size, rect_delta, layers)
* Drill(size, offset)
* Net(code, name)
* Model(path, at, scale, rotate)
* Text(prop, value, at, layer, hide, size, thickness)
* Line(start, end, layer, width)
* Circle(center, end, layer, width)
* Arc(start, end, angle, layer, width)

### Functions
* find_library(library)
* find_module(library, module)
* list_libraries()
* list_modules(library)
* list_all_modules()

### Global variables
* MODULE_SEARCH_PATH
